#ConsciousContent Calendar: January 2021



Hooray it’s 2021! Snow is on the ground, change is in the air, and there’s so much to look forward to in this first month of the year. New Year’s Day is just the first of many special days in January, a month that presents an exciting array of ways to engage with audiences. And yet, creating relevant, meaningful content is no easy task. Thankfully we’ve put together a calendar resource that has all of the upcoming holidays, events, and season-related dates in one place.

Whatever your resolutions for this year may be, staying organized and on track in planning content is a great way to start. Our #ConsciousContent calendar resource is downloadable right onto your own google calendar, and is a great tool for staying on top of the dates relevant to your audience. Not only cheerful days such as National Hugging Day on January 21st, but also important days of social advocacy like Martin Luther King Jr. Day on January 18th. By staying up to date on important dates, you’ll be able to create relevant, informed content that can then drive your larger strategic goals.

Okay, I downloaded it. Now what?

Now it’s time to plan! Not every date on the #ConsciousContent Calendar is relevant to your organization. But a lot probably are, so it is important to look through them and recognize opportunities to engage with all of the stakeholders in your organization. Establishing a clear and consistent position through your social media affects your ability to recruit volunteers and maintain relationships with donors. Show them that you’re paying attention, and that you want to be part of the conversation on days like National Cut Your Energy Costs Day on January 10th. Or maybe, International Mentoring Day on January 17th provides a unique opportunity for you to engage on social media and drive your larger strategic goals.
